Version differences

The Steam version is Direct3D 11-only, while the Microsoft Store version is Direct3D 12-only. Performance of the Steam-version has been improved on Nvidia-hardware and stayed the same on AMD-hardware compared to the Microsoft Store version. Steam-version does not suffer from graphics-driver crashes on Nvidia-hardware, whereas the Microsoft Store version did (at least since launch of the game.)[4] It is unknown if these graphics-driver crashes have been fixed since then for the Microsoft Store version.
Steam-version is more up-to-date compared to the Microsoft Store version, as Remedy announced in August 2016 that they wouldn't release any more updates for the Microsoft Store version, while the last update for the Steam version got released on October 2016.[5][6]

Video

By default, renders at 2/3 of the selected resolution then 'temporally reconstructed' to selected resolution.[8] Originally couldn't be disabled, but option to toggle it was added in a later update.[9][10] Set Upscaling to Off to render at native selected resolution, but this will come at a high performance cost.[11]

Issues fixed

Jack wearing an eyepatch

Playing the Microsoft Store version while signed out of the Store app triggers this issue.
Open the Store app and sign into the Microsoft account that owns the game before playing[18]

Nvidia SLI support (Steam version)

SLI support can be set manually for the Steam version (up to 95% scaling).[19]
Use Nvidia Inspector[19][20]
  1. Open Nvidia Profile Inspector.
  2. Find the Quantum Break profile
  3. Set the SLI compatibility flag for its DX11 mode to 0x080002F5
  4. Go to the SLI section
  5. Set number of GPUs to SLI_PREDEFINED_GPU_COUNT_DX10_FOUR
  6. Set Nvidia predefined SLI mode on DirectX 10 to SLI_PREDEFINED_MODE_DX10_FORCE_AFR

CPU doesn't support POPCNT instruction

If your CPU doesn't support the POPCNT instruction, then your CPU is below the system requirements of this game. Still, with the below workaround, you might be able to run the game. Still, expect the game to run poorly on your PC.
Although the developers state that POPCNT instruction is required[21] to run the game, in reality this is not true, at least for the Steam release.
For Windows Store version see this workaround
Remove POPCNT check in rl_x64_f.dll[22]
  1. Get hex editor. HxD is free, portable and easy to use.
  2. Open <path-to-game>\dx11\rl_x64_f.dll in hex editor. Use "Browse local files" in Steam game options to find path to Quantum Break folder.
  3. Search for 0FBAE117730A hex string.
  4. Replace it with 0FBAE1179090 hex string.
